WebJul 10, 2024 · Massaging your sinuses can help drain them and relieve pressure and pain. Here's how to do a general sinus massage: Press your index fingers into the sides of your head at your temples. Rub in small circles. Move your fingers and thumbs to your eyebrows and apply pressure for a few seconds.
